Overview
Engineering/Maintenance Manager (Multi-Site) – Location: North West (Clitheroe & Speke). Salary negotiable DOE. Permanent.
Lead maintenance strategy, asset reliability and CAPEX delivery across two high‑performance manufacturing sites.
Key Responsibilities
* Leadership: Lead and develop the Maintenance Team; allocate daily tasks; ensure tooling, spares and resources; manage training/competency with HR.
* H&S & Compliance: Ensure robust risk assessments/SOPs; act as the responsible person for contractor‑controlled works; meet all H&S and relevant trade/legislative standards.
* Asset Care & Strategy: Own reliability of production assets and facilities (production & offices); maintain OEE above targets via PM and RCA; coordinate with Production to plan maintenance and optimise downtime.
* Spares & Procurement: Oversee spares (excluding main line consumables); operate within procurement policy; authorise purchases up to £2,000 and approve relevant invoices.
* Finance & CAPEX: Control maintenance/repairs/renewals budgets; develop budgets with the Operations Director and Finance Director; build and deliver CAPEX plans with Operations/Production.
* Quality & Assurance: Ensure site QC procedures; implement processes to meet legislative and trade assurance requirements.
* Strategic Impact: Contribute to business strategy; support senior leadership/Board; represent the company professionally.
What You\'ll Bring
* Proven leadership of maintenance/engineering teams; develops talent and holds teams to account.
* Excellent planning/organisational skills across competing priorities and resources.
* Credible communicator at shop-floor and senior levels.
* Commercially astute with strong financial insight and performance focus.
* Robust H&S knowledge and best practice (risk assessments, safe systems of work).
* Desirable: IOSH Managing Safely (or similar); process manufacturing & multi-site experience; OEE improvement via PM/RCA/RCM; CMMS and contractor management.
